Output 57c14f5a3ac383ed2462bb66cdd95b19156ea9880a89cc2e14c39206e45c37bf:2

value
1756000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e15373a75089092995f74c55a4c29d062110462 OP_EQUAL
address
AFbjiD87eqR2fEeNCJ3VtF45D1yuopjbqL
transaction
57c14f5a3ac383ed2462bb66cdd95b19156ea9880a89cc2e14c39206e45c37bf